A gift for a boss or mentor lives in a narrow corridor — warm enough to be sincere, restrained enough to remain professional. These three Chinese characters have been the diplomatic gift for centuries: respectful, classical, never overdone.
财 (Cái) — Prosperity / Career Success
A practical and traditional choice. 财 is the wish for continued success — for the business, the team, and the years of leadership ahead. The most common Chinese gift for a boss or business contact.
寿 (Shòu) — Longevity / Vitality
A traditional Chinese gift of respect for an elder colleague or longtime mentor. 寿 acknowledges seniority gracefully — a wish for many more good years.
瑞 (Ruì) — Auspicious
For a boss starting a new venture, expansion, or chapter. 瑞 is the formal Chinese blessing for new beginnings — auspicious, professional, classical.
